  5. Every year, millions of Mexican free-tailed bats return to The Selman Bat Cave Wildlife Management Area near Freedom, Oklahoma as part of their migratory path. The bats travel over 1,400 miles to give birth to their young and care for them in this protected area.

  7. The Ozark Cave Preserves are made up of three different properties protecting a combined 316 acres across northeastern Oklahoma. These preserves protect a limestone cave, rare bats and an underground stream where unique aquatic species can be found.
